EVS-EN 16265:2015

Pyrotechnic articles - Other pyrotechnic articles - Ignition devices

This European Standard defines the terms and specifies the requirements, means of categorisation, test methods, minimum labelling requirements and instructions for use, for ignition devices (except ignition devices for pyrotechnic articles for vehicles) of the following generic types: igniters; components for pyrotechnic trains; pyrotechnic Cords and fuses; delay fuses; fuzes. NOTE Safety fuses are subject to Directive 93/15/EEC and therefore not considered in this European Standard. This European Standard does not apply for articles containing pyrotechnic compositions that include any of the following substances: arsenic or arsenic compounds; polychlorobenzenes; mercury compounds; white phosphorus; picrates or picric acid. This European Standard does not apply to pyrotechnic articles containing blasting agents and military explosives except black powder and flash composition.
